我正在使用Docker映像建立多节点Hyperledger Sawtooth网络。我能够在3个AWS VM上启动Sawtooth Validator,Settings TP和intkey TP,但是,Validator无法相互连接。我收到以下错误:
尝试删除连接的send_message函数OutboundConnectionThread-tcp://3.xxx.xxx.xxx:8800,但未注册send_message函数 [警告调度]试图删除连接的send_last_message函数OutboundConnectionThread-tcp://3.xxx.xxx.xxx:8800,但未注册send_last_message函数
任何解决该问题的指针将非常有帮助。谢谢!
答案 0 :(得分:3)
这是我在https://chat.hyperledger.org/channel/sawtooth
中发布的答案这看起来像是ZMQ错误。它无法连接,因此在任务结束的清理过程中断开连接时出现错误。真正的错误应该更早。但是我认为根本原因是缺乏网络连接。尝试以下技巧,看看它们是否有帮助: https://sawtooth.hyperledger.org/faq/installation/#i-get-this-error-after-setting-up-a-sawtooth-network-can-t-send-message-ping-response-back-to-because-connection-outboundconnectionthread-tcp-192-168-0-100-8800-not-in-dispatcher